Supporting Healthy Aging: A Guide to Senior Dog Food

As our canine companions enter their golden years, their nutritional needs change. A diet tailored specifically for senior dogs can help them maintain a healthy weight, boost their overall well-being, and support joint health.

Senior dog food often contains higher amounts of certain nutrients like protein, fiber, and omega-3 fatty acids. These ingredients can help with muscle mass preservation, digestion, and reducing inflammation. Additionally, senior dog food may be easier to digest to accommodate the changes that occur as dogs grow older.

When selecting a senior dog food, consider factors like your dog's breed. Consult with your veterinarian to determine the best diet for your furry friend's individual needs. Providing them with wholesome food can help them enjoy their golden years to the fullest.
